Summer Variety Auction

Summertime "No Reserve" Auction. Our warehouse is loaded, and all items will be sold to the highest bidder. Mark your calendar and join us on July 28th for this special auction, where we have over 200 lots to be sold. The auction features three art glass collections with no reserves, including pieces from Galle, Daum Nancy, Schneider, and Lalique. Additionally, there will be an original Icart pastel, bronze figurines, a rare Monkey automaton, rare Edward Curtis bluetone photographs from the early 20th century, vintage nude photos, and a Salvador Dali original print.
